FERREIRA, Juliana Martins et al. Gerontotechnology for fall prevention: promotion of health of the elderly with Parkinson's disease. Index Enferm [online]. 2019, vol.28, n.1-2, pp.61-65.  Epub 09-Dez-2019. ISSN 1699-5988.

Objective:

Evaluate the contribution of gerontotechnologies in nursing care to promote the health of the elderly with Parkinson's disease to prevent falls.

Methods:

The Convergent Care Survey was used through the construction and application of educational material developed by clinical evaluation, semi-structured recorded interview and workshops. The evaluation of the elaborated materials was carried out by ten judges, selected by the list of graduates in gerontology of the Brazilian Society of Geriatrics and Gerontology, who used the Gerontotechnology Assessment and Suitability Assessment of Materials.

Results:

The research pointed out that it takes, at least, six years of study for the elderly to understand the gerontotechnology used. The objectives related to content, text comprehension, motivation and cultural adaptation were achieved.

Conclusions:

Gerontotechnologies are effective in preventing falls, since they provide knowledge about Parkinson's disease, environmental prevention and safety actions, and contribute to the process of reflection through health promotion, making the elderly protagonist of their care process.
